What is Wholesale Real Estate?
Wholesale real estate, also known as wholesaling, is a short-term strategy where an investor acts as a middleman to buy a property under market value and sell the contract to another buyer for a slightly higher price. The investor profits from the difference without making any repairs or improvements. Here’s how it works:
- Contract The investor makes a purchase contract with the seller, sometimes for a small earnest money deposit. The contract specifies the sale price and timeframe.
- Find a buyer The investor seeks an interested buyer to reassign the contract to at a higher price.
- Profit The difference between the purchase and sale price is the wholesale fee, which can range from 5–10% of the property value. So to be transparent, this is how we make a profit.
What’s the advantage selling your home to a wholesale real estate investor?
The main advantage of selling your home to a wholesale real estate investor is the potential for a quick and efficient sale, often with a motivated seller, as wholesalers can bring a cash buyer to the table quickly. This process can also save sellers money by avoiding the traditional costs of a standard real estate sale, such as agent commissions and fees.
Speed and efficiency
- Quick close: Wholesalers often have a network of cash buyers ready to purchase, which can lead to a fast closing, sometimes in a matter of weeks.
- Streamlined process: The transaction can be more efficient because the wholesaler is focused on closing a deal quickly, rather than a traditional sale that can be delayed by inspections, appraisals, or financing.
Cost savings
- No commissions or fees: Unlike a standard sale through an agent, selling to a wholesaler can mean no commission is paid, which can save the seller a significant amount of money.
- Simplified transaction: The wholesaler typically handles the costs involved in the transaction, so the seller is not responsible for many of the expenses associated with selling a home.
Other potential advantages
- Motivated sellers: Wholesalers often work with sellers who are motivated to sell quickly, such as those facing foreclosure or a difficult financial situation.
- “As-is” sale: The property is often sold in its current condition, meaning the seller does not have to deal with the cost and hassle of making repairs or upgrades before selling.
- Large Network: Wholesalers have a large network of cash home buyers to help sell homes fast.
Example of a Wholesale Real Estate Deal
- Wholesale Real Estate Investor finds a homeowner who needs to sell a run-down house quickly and agrees to a purchase price of $90,000.
- The wholesaler then finds an investor who is willing to buy the house for $100,000.
- The wholesaler assigns the $90,000 purchase contract to the investor for a $10,000 fee.
- The Investor pays the $10,000 fee to the wholesaler and then closes the sale with the homeowner for $90,000.
